WebClimate Change May Shift or Shrink Penguin Habitat. 1981 - 2010. What was once a good thing for Adélie penguins is becoming too much of a good thing. For thousands of years, spells of warm weather along the coast of Antarctica helped penguin populations thrive. Milder weather meant more bare-rock locations for the birds to lay their eggs and ...

Web10 Nov 2024 · Penguins that either live or breed in Oceania are the little penguin, erect-crested penguin, Fiordland-crested penguin, Snares Island penguin, yellow-eyed penguin, and royal penguin. The Fiordland, Snares Island, and yellow-eyed are all native to New Zealand.. http://jdp.co.uk/programmes/penguins-spy-in-the-huddle Web24 Feb 2024 · penguin, (order Sphenisciformes), any of 18–21 species of flightless marine birds that live only in the Southern Hemisphere. The majority of species live not in Antarctica but rather between latitudes 45° and 60° S, where they breed on islands. A few penguins inhabit temperate regions, and one, the Galapagos penguin (Spheniscus mendiculus), …
